Jesus Turns Water into Wine at the Wedding in Cana
Here we see Jesus move at his mom’s request. She doesn't actually ask Him for a miracle; she simply points out the need: “They have no wine.” It’s such a beautiful picture of a mom understanding her son's heart and His Father's heart. She knows Him well enough to know He'll do the right thing, which leads us to question if we can come to Him with that same sort of trust.

About this Plan

Jesus performed many signs, but John recorded seven so that his readers would believe. This plan has the same aim. It presents a collection of miracles that Jesus and his disciples performed, showing us God’s character, His heart toward humanity, and His ability to move on our behalf. Not only that, we have Jesus' promise that through the power of the Holy Spirit, we will do those things and more.
